Commercial Slab Installation in Sarasota, FL

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ations for a variety of property projects, including parking lots, building bases, walkways, and loading areas. These projects typically require precise planning and execution to ensure durability and proper support for ongoing use. Property owners interested in this service should understand the importance of site preparation, including proper grading and soil assessment, as well as the need for quality materials and accurate measurements to meet project specifications.

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ners often want to know about the scope of work, including whether the service covers site clearing, reinforcement, and finishing details. It’s also helpful to consider factors like the intended use of the slab, local building codes, and any specific design requirements. Clear communication about these aspects can help ensure the project meets expectations and provides a stable, long-lasting foundation for commercial or industrial needs.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ions

What types of projects require a commercial slab installation? Commercial slab installations are often used for building foundations, parking areas, loading docks, and outdoor workspaces on property sites in Sarasota and nearby areas.

How thick should a commercial concrete slab be? The thickness of a commercial slab depends on its intended use, typically ranging from 4 to 6 inches for standard applications, with thicker slabs used for heavier loads.

What preparation is needed before installing a commercial slab? Proper site preparation includes clearing the area, ensuring a stable base, and installing formwork and reinforcement to support the concrete once poured.

What materials are commonly used in commercial slab construction? Reinforced concrete with steel rebar or wire mesh is commonly used to provide strength and durability for commercial slabs in various property projects.
